Understanding Dental Emergencies in Calvert WI
A dental emergency is defined as a condition that requires immediate attention to alleviate severe pain, stop bleeding, or prevent further damage to the teeth, mouth, or jaw. These situations are often characterized by intense pain, swelling, or trauma. Common dental emergencies include:
- Severe toothaches that are unbearable.
- Chipped, cracked, or broken teeth.
- Knocked-out teeth (avulsed teeth).
- Lost fillings or crowns.
- Abscesses or infections with swelling and fever.
- Bleeding that won’t stop.
- Injuries to the mouth or jaw.

What to Expect During an Emergency Dental Visit
Upon arriving at a dental emergency clinic in or near Calvert, the process typically begins with a thorough examination by the dentist. They will assess the severity of the issue, discuss your symptoms, and may take X-rays to get a clearer picture of what’s happening. The treatment plan will be tailored to your specific condition, aiming to relieve pain and resolve the underlying problem.
Common treatment methods for dental emergencies may include:
- Pain Management: Administration of local anesthesia and potentially pain medication to alleviate discomfort.
- Addressing Trauma: For chipped or broken teeth, dentists might use bonding agents, veneers, or crowns depending on the extent of the damage. In cases of knocked-out teeth, immediate reimplantation or stabilization is crucial for the best chance of saving the tooth.
- Infection Control: For abscesses or infections, a dentist will drain the infected area and prescribe antibiotics to combat the bacteria. Root canal therapy may also be necessary.
- Replacement and Repair: For lost fillings or crowns, temporary or permanent restorations can be placed to protect the tooth and restore function.
The materials used in emergency dental care are of high quality, similar to those used in general dentistry, ensuring durable and effective solutions. This could involve biocompatible filling materials, dental cements, and restorative materials for crowns.
The Importance of Prompt Action
Delaying treatment for a dental emergency can have serious consequences. A simple chipped tooth can become more susceptible to infection, and a severe toothache can indicate a deeper problem that, if left untreated, could lead to tooth loss or more widespread health issues. For instance, an untreated dental abscess can, in rare cases, spread infection to other parts of the body. Therefore, seeking immediate dental intervention in Calvert is not just about pain relief, but also about preserving your oral health and preventing potential complications.

Q3: My tooth was knocked out. What should I do, and how does a dentist typically handle this in an emergency?
A3: If a tooth is knocked out, it’s a critical emergency. First, try to find the tooth and handle it only by the crown (the chewing surface), avoiding touching the root. Rinse the tooth gently with water if it’s dirty, but do not scrub it. If possible, try to reinsert the tooth into its socket. If that’s not feasible, place the tooth in a container of milk or saliva. Then, immediately contact an emergency dentist. Dentists will attempt to reimplant the tooth as quickly as possible, splint it in place, and monitor healing. The sooner treatment is received, the higher the chance of saving the tooth.
